LA5 Newsletter
This term, our class has focused on strengthening our Positive Behaviour Support (PBS) routines and expectations, creating a supportive and respectful learning environment. We have also been developing our communication skills, using Touch Chat to learn how to request our favourite items and games. In addition, we have been working on building our self-regulation skills to help manage emotions and behaviours throughout the school day.










On Thursday morning before our swimmers headed off to the pool, we got together as a school and showed each other the Easter crafts we have been doing, we danced to music, explored some sensory play and made hot cross buns and biscuits. This was all followed by a very special visit from our friend the Easter Bunny!
